Output 28ac87c8cd3a58db83bf69995eebacdb052d43b313170283a7d9ecebb493cf48:0

value
135746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89365ac411cf225310adc785fb648992057c19a1 OP_EQUAL
address
3ECXcSmn2Dytt13JZfmQXRsx8jNBwGKQum
transaction
28ac87c8cd3a58db83bf69995eebacdb052d43b313170283a7d9ecebb493cf48
confirmations
176956
spent
true